The video tutorial explains the concept of compatible numbers, which are used to simplify mental math by rounding numbers to the nearest ten, hundred, or thousand. Compatible numbers help in estimating results for add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division. The tutorial provides examples for each operation, demonstrating how rounding can make calculations easier and faster.
